The DHI-HY-KIT1-SLVP WisuAlarm Alarm Kit for the Deaf and Hard of Hearing is designed to provide additional fire and gas alarm awareness for people who may not hear a standard sounder during an emergency.
The kit uses both a bright strobe light and a vibration pad to alert occupants when a compatible WisuAlarm device is activated. This combination of visual and tactile warning helps make alarms easier to recognise, particularly during sleep or in areas where an audible alarm may not be enough.
The strobe unit is powered by mains electricity and includes a rechargeable lithium battery backup, helping maintain protection if the power supply is interrupted. The vibration pad connects directly to the strobe and can be positioned under a pillow, mattress or seat cushion for effective personal alerting.
Using wireless interconnection, the kit can be paired with compatible WisuAlarm smoke, heat, carbon monoxide and gas alarms. It supports up to 24 linked devices, so when one connected alarm is triggered, the strobe and vibration pad activate automatically.
Built-in LED indicators give a clear view of the system condition, including fire, gas, fault, power and pairing status. This makes the unit easier to check during installation, testing and routine use.
Designed for indoor applications, the alarm kit is suitable for bedrooms, hotels, care environments, hospitals, student accommodation and other settings where enhanced alarm notification may be required.
The strobe light can be wall mounted or placed free-standing, depending on the layout of the room. A one-touch self-test function is also included to support regular system checks.
The kit is compliant with BS 5446-3:2015, confirming its suitability as a fire alarm device for deaf and hard of hearing users.
